During a meningococcal (group A) epidemic, 47 Nigerian children with acute meningococcaemia without meningitis were studied. Their mortality rate was 43% compared with 8% during the whole epidemic. Those presenting with coma and shock had a mortality of 93%, but without shock or coma mortality was only 6%. Coma or shock occurring alone carried an intermediate prognosis. Two cases of alcoholic coma are presented where extensor responses to noxious stimuli are demonstrated. Decerebrate posturing normally indicates severe structural or functional depression of midbrain function but can be caused by depressant drugs. Congenital ocular motor apraxia (COMA) is a unique ocular motor disorder which is characterized by a deficit in initiation of voluntary horizontal eye movement with reserved reflex eye movement. Although a portion of cases with COMA were found to be associated with other abnormalities, COMA in most patients is an isolated disorder. The existence of an intergalactic globular cluster population in the Coma cluster of galaxies has been tested using surface-brightness fluctuations. The main result is that the intergalactic globular cluster surface density (N IGC) does not correlate with the distance to the center of Coma and hence with the environment.
